Output 62511f9581d03edaa1dd8865c9a5bda84d03a20337660294a525d9dc37560c15:2

value
29083132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 044d7ac2ea509488f9881002707bcc5e81ffe618 OP_EQUAL
address
M8Huka23vxJ7UjX3voGayxo5n8mMbEePAn
transaction
62511f9581d03edaa1dd8865c9a5bda84d03a20337660294a525d9dc37560c15
spent
true